We are seeking a highly motivated Postdoctoral Fellow to work on AI-driven MRI image reconstruction and motion correction, with a focus on fetal, neonatal, and pediatric imaging. The position sits at the intersection of MRI physics, machine learning, and clinical translation.
Research Focus: The fellow will develop advanced AI methods for: 1) Motion-robust reconstruction in non-Cartesian MRI 2) Learning-based and physics-informed reconstruction (e.g., unrolled networks, self-supervised and diffusion models) 3) Motion estimation and correction 4) Quantitative MRI under severe motion.
Qualifications: 1) PhD in Biomedical Engineering, Electrical Engineering, Computer Science, Physics, or related fields 2) Strong background in image reconstruction, inverse problems, or machine learning 3) Experience with deep learning (PyTorch/TensorFlow) / Python / C /C++ programming.
